Top Engineering Degrees Ranked: Find the Best Program for You

Choosing the right engineering discipline is a decision that shapes careers, lifestyles, and long-term financial stability. With numerous specializations available, understanding how engineering degrees ranked helps prospective students align their academic paths with market demands and personal interests. The landscape of engineering is vast, ranging from established fields like civil and mechanical engineering to cutting-edge domains such as biomedical and software engineering.

Overview of Engineering Disciplines

Engineering degrees ranked by popularity often highlight disciplines that combine theoretical rigor with practical application. Core branches include mechanical, electrical, civil, chemical, and computer engineering, each serving as a foundation for specific industries. These traditional fields remain highly sought after due to their versatility and the critical infrastructure they support globally.

Recent shifts in technology and sustainability have reshaped how engineering degrees ranked in modern curricula. Disciplines focused on renewable energy, data science, and robotics have surged in prominence. Universities now emphasize interdisciplinary studies, allowing students to merge core engineering principles with emerging fields like artificial intelligence and environmental science.

Interdisciplinary Growth

Programs blending engineering with business, design, or healthcare are gaining traction. This evolution reflects the industry’s demand for professionals who can navigate complex, real-world challenges. For instance, biomedical engineering combines medical knowledge with technical innovation, creating opportunities in healthcare technology and research.

Industry Demand and Career Outcomes

Engineering degrees ranked by employment rates often correlate with sectors experiencing rapid growth. Technology, energy, and infrastructure sectors consistently seek skilled engineers. Specializations in cybersecurity, aerospace, and sustainable development are particularly lucrative, offering competitive salaries and robust job security in a dynamic global market.

Geographic and Economic Factors

Regional industry needs influence which engineering degrees ranked highest in specific areas. For example, coastal regions may prioritize ocean engineering, while tech hubs favor software or computer engineering. Economic trends also play a role, with emerging markets driving demand for civil and industrial engineers to support urbanization.

Choosing the Right Program

Prospective students should evaluate engineering degrees ranked not solely by prestige, but by alignment with personal goals. Factors such as accreditation, faculty expertise, research opportunities, and internship partnerships are critical. A program’s location and industry connections can significantly impact networking and post-graduation prospects.

Long-Term Impact

Beyond initial salary, engineering degrees ranked by long-term career adaptability matter. Fields like mechanical or electrical engineering provide broad foundations, while niche specializations may offer faster advancement in targeted industries. Continuous learning and professional certification further enhance mobility and resilience against market fluctuations.
